- /** @file
- EFI ISA ACPI Protocol is used to enumerate and manage all the ISA controllers on
- the platform's ISA Bus.
- Copyright (c) 2006 - 2018, Intel Corporation. All rights reserved.<BR>
- SPDX-License-Identifier: BSD-2-Clause-Patent
- **/
- #ifndef __ISA_ACPI_H_
- #define __ISA_ACPI_H_
- ///
- /// Global ID for the EFI ISA ACPI Protocol.
- ///
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L_GUID \
- { \
- 0x64a892dc, 0x5561, 0x4536, { 0x92, 0xc7, 0x79, 0x9b, 0xfc, 0x18, 0x33, 0x55 } \
- }
- ///
- /// Forward declaration fo the EFI ISA ACPI Protocol
- ///
- typedef struct _E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L;
- ///
- /// ISA ACPI Protocol interrupt resource attributes.
- ///
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_IRQ_TYPE_HIGH_TRUE_EDGE_SENSITIVE 0x01 ///< Edge triggered interrupt on a rising edge.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_IRQ_TYPE_LOW_TRUE_EDGE_SENSITIVE 0x02 ///< Edge triggered interrupt on a falling edge.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_IRQ_TYPE_HIGH_TRUE_LEVEL_SENSITIVE 0x04 ///< Level sensitive interrupt active high.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_IRQ_TYPE_LOW_TRUE_LEVEL_SENSITIVE 0x08 ///< Level sensitive interrupt active low.
- ///
- /// ISA ACPI Protocol DMA resource attributes.
- ///
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_SPEED_TYPE_MASK 0x03 ///< Bit mask of supported DMA speed attributes.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_SPEED_TYPE_COMPATIBILITY 0x00 ///< ISA controller supports compatibility mode DMA transfers.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_SPEED_TYPE_A 0x01 ///< ISA controller supports type A DMA transfers.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_SPEED_TYPE_B 0x02 ///< ISA controller supports type B DMA transfers.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_SPEED_TYPE_F 0x03 ///< ISA controller supports type F DMA transfers.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_COUNT_BY_BYTE 0x04 ///< ISA controller increments DMA address by bytes (8-bit).
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_COUNT_BY_WORD 0x08 ///< ISA controller increments DMA address by words (16-bit).
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_BUS_MASTER 0x10 ///< ISA controller is a DMA bus master.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_TRANSFER_TYPE_8_BIT 0x20 ///< ISA controller only supports 8-bit DMA transfers.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_TRANSFER_TYPE_8_BIT_AND_16_BIT 0x40 ///< ISA controller both 8-bit and 16-bit DMA transfers.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_DMA_TRANSFER_TYPE_16_BIT 0x80 ///< ISA controller only supports 16-bit DMA transfers.
- ///
- /// ISA ACPI Protocol MMIO resource attributes
- ///
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_MEMORY_WIDTH_MASK 0x03 ///< Bit mask of supported ISA memory width attributes.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_MEMORY_WIDTH_8_BIT 0x00 ///< ISA MMIO region only supports 8-bit access.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_MEMORY_WIDTH_16_BIT 0x01 ///< ISA MMIO region only supports 16-bit access.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_MEMORY_WIDTH_8_BIT_AND_16_BIT 0x02 ///< ISA MMIO region supports both 8-bit and 16-bit access.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_MEMORY_WRITEABLE 0x04 ///< ISA MMIO region supports write transactions.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_MEMORY_CACHEABLE 0x08 ///< ISA MMIO region supports being cached.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_MEMORY_SHADOWABLE 0x10 ///< ISA MMIO region may be shadowed.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_MEMORY_EXPANSION_ROM 0x20 ///< ISA MMIO region is an expansion ROM.
- ///
- /// ISA ACPI Protocol I/O resource attributes
- ///
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_IO_DECODE_10_BITS 0x01 ///< ISA controllers uses a 10-bit address decoder for I/O cycles.
- #define EFI_ISA_ACPI_IO_DECODE_16_BITS 0x02 ///< ISA controllers uses a 16-bit address decoder for I/O cycles.
- ///
- /// EFI ISA ACPI resource type
- ///
- typedef enum {
- EfiIsaAcpiResourceEndOfList, ///< Marks the end if a resource list.
- EfiIsaAcpiResourceIo, ///< ISA I/O port resource range.
- EfiIsaAcpiResourceMemory, ///< ISA MMIO resource range.
- EfiIsaAcpiResourceDma, ///< ISA DMA resource.
- EfiIsaAcpiResourceInterrupt ///< ISA interrupt resource.
- } EFI_ISA_ACPI_RESOURCE_TYPE;
- ///
- /// EFI ISA ACPI generic resource structure
- ///
- typedef struct {
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_RESOURCE_TYPE Type; ///< The type of resource (I/O, MMIO, DMA, Interrupt).
- UINT32 Attribute; ///< Bit mask of attributes associated with this resource. See EFI_ISA_ACPI_xxx macros for valid combinations.
- UINT32 StartRange; ///< The start of the resource range.
- UINT32 EndRange; ///< The end of the resource range.
- } EFI_ISA_ACPI_RESOURCE;
- ///
- /// EFI ISA ACPI resource device identifier
- ///
- typedef struct {
- UINT32 HID; ///< The ACPI Hardware Identifier value associated with an ISA controller. Matchs ACPI DSDT contents.
- UINT32 UID; ///< The ACPI Unique Identifier value associated with an ISA controller. Matches ACPI DSDT contents.
- } E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ID;
- ///
- /// EFI ISA ACPI resource list
- ///
- typedef struct {
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ID Device; ///< The ACPI HID/UID associated with an ISA controller.
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_RESOURCE *ResourceItem; ///< A pointer to the list of resources associated with an ISA controller.
- } EFI_ISA_ACPI_RESOURCE_LIST;
- /**
- Enumerates the ISA controllers on an ISA bus.
- This service allows all the ISA controllers on an ISA bus to be enumerated. If
- Device is a pointer to a NULL value, then the first ISA controller on the ISA
- bus is returned in Device and EFI_SUCCESS is returned. If Device is a pointer
- to a value that was returned on a prior call to DeviceEnumerate(), then the next
- ISA controller on the ISA bus is returned in Device and EFI_SUCCESS is returned.
- If Device is a pointer to the last ISA controller on the ISA bus, then
- EFI_NOT_FOUND is returned.
- @param[in] This The pointer to the E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L instance.
- @param[out] Device The pointer to an ISA controller named by ACPI HID/UID.
- @retval EFI_SUCCESS The next ISA controller on the ISA bus was returned.
- @retval EFI_NOT_FOUND No device found.
- **/
- typedef
- EFI_STATUS
- (EFIAPI *E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ENUMERATE)(
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L *This,
- OUT E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ID **Device
- );
- /**
- Sets the power state of an ISA controller.
- This services sets the power state of the ISA controller specified by Device to
- the power state specified by OnOff. TRUE denotes on, FALSE denotes off.
- If the power state is successfully set on the ISA Controller, then
- EFI_SUCCESS is returned.
- @param[in] This The pointer to the E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L instance.
- @param[in] Device The pointer to an ISA controller named by ACPI HID/UID.
- @param[in] OnOff TRUE denotes on, FALSE denotes off.
- @retval EFI_SUCCESS Successfully set the power state of the ISA controller.
- @retval Other The ISA controller could not be placed in the requested power state.
- **/
- typedef
- EFI_STATUS
- (EFIAPI *EFI_ISA_ACPI_SET_DEVICE_POWER)(
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L *This,
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ID *Device,
- IN BOOLEAN OnOff
- );
- /**
- Retrieves the current set of resources associated with an ISA controller.
- Retrieves the set of I/O, MMIO, DMA, and interrupt resources currently
- assigned to the ISA controller specified by Device. These resources
- are returned in ResourceList.
- @param[in] This The pointer to the E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L instance.
- @param[in] Device The pointer to an ISA controller named by ACPI HID/UID.
- @param[out] ResourceList The pointer to the current resource list for Device.
- @retval EFI_SUCCESS Successfully retrieved the current resource list.
- @retval EFI_NOT_FOUND The resource list could not be retrieved.
- **/
- typedef
- EFI_STATUS
- (EFIAPI *EFI_ISA_ACPI_GET_CUR_RESOURCE)(
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L *This,
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ID *Device,
- OUT EFI_ISA_ACPI_RESOURCE_LIST **ResourceList
- );
- /**
- Retrieves the set of possible resources that may be assigned to an ISA controller
- with SetResource().
- Retrieves the possible sets of I/O, MMIO, DMA, and interrupt resources for the
- ISA controller specified by Device. The sets are returned in ResourceList.
- @param[in] This The pointer to the E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L instance.
- @param[in] Device The pointer to an ISA controller named by ACPI HID/UID.
- @param[out] ResourceList The pointer to the returned list of resource lists.
- @retval EFI_UNSUPPORTED This service is not supported.
- **/
- typedef
- EFI_STATUS
- (EFIAPI *EFI_ISA_ACPI_GET_POS_RESOURCE)(
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L *This,
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ID *Device,
- OUT EFI_ISA_ACPI_RESOURCE_LIST **ResourceList
- );
- /**
- Assigns resources to an ISA controller.
- Assigns the I/O, MMIO, DMA, and interrupt resources specified by ResourceList
- to the ISA controller specified by Device. ResourceList must match a resource list returned by GetPosResource() for the same ISA controller.
- @param[in] This The pointer to the E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L instance.
- @param[in] Device The pointer to an ISA controller named by ACPI HID/UID.
- @param[in] ResourceList The pointer to a resources list that must be one of the
- resource lists returned by GetPosResource() for the
- ISA controller specified by Device.
- @retval EFI_SUCCESS Successfully set resources on the ISA controller.
- @retval Other The resources could not be set for the ISA controller.
- **/
- typedef
- EFI_STATUS
- (EFIAPI *EFI_ISA_ACPI_SET_RESOURCE)(
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L *This,
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ID *Device,
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_RESOURCE_LIST *ResourceList
- );
- /**
- Enables or disables an ISA controller.
- @param[in] This The pointer to the E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L instance.
- @param[in] Device The pointer to the ISA controller to enable/disable.
- @param[in] Enable TRUE to enable the ISA controller. FALSE to disable the
- ISA controller.
- @retval EFI_SUCCESS Successfully enabled/disabled the ISA controller.
- @retval Other The ISA controller could not be placed in the requested state.
- **/
- typedef
- EFI_STATUS
- (EFIAPI *EFI_ISA_ACPI_ENABLE_DEVICE)(
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L *This,
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ID *Device,
- IN BOOLEAN Enable
- );
- /**
- Initializes an ISA controller, so that it can be used. This service must be called
- before SetResource(), EnableDevice(), or SetPower() will behave as expected.
- @param[in] This The pointer to the E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L instance.
- @param[in] Device The pointer to an ISA controller named by ACPI HID/UID.
- @retval EFI_SUCCESS Successfully initialized an ISA controller.
- @retval Other The ISA controller could not be initialized.
- **/
- typedef
- EFI_STATUS
- (EFIAPI *EFI_ISA_ACPI_INIT_DEVICE)(
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L *This,
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ID *Device
- );
- /**
- Initializes all the HW states required for the ISA controllers on the ISA bus
- to be enumerated and managed by the rest of the services in this prorotol.
- This service must be called before any of the other services in this
- protocol will function as expected.
- @param[in] This The pointer to the E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L instance.
- @retval EFI_SUCCESS Successfully initialized all required hardware states.
- @retval Other The ISA interface could not be initialized.
- **/
- typedef
- EFI_STATUS
- (EFIAPI *EFI_ISA_ACPI_INTERFACE_INIT)(
- IN E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L *This
- );
- ///
- /// The E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L provides the services to enumerate and manage
- /// ISA controllers on an ISA bus. These services include the ability to initialize,
- /// enable, disable, and manage the power state of ISA controllers. It also
- /// includes services to query current resources, query possible resources,
- /// and assign resources to an ISA controller.
- ///
- struct _EFI_ISA_ACPI_PROTOCOL {
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_DEVICE_ENUMERATE DeviceEnumerate;
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_SET_DEVICE_POWER SetPower;
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_GET_CUR_RESOURCE GetCurResource;
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_GET_POS_RESOURCE GetPosResource;
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_SET_RESOURCE SetResource;
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_ENABLE_DEVICE EnableDevice;
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_INIT_DEVICE InitDevice;
- EFI_ISA_ACPI_INTERFACE_INIT InterfaceInit;
- };
- extern EFI_GUID gEfiIsaAcpiProtocolGuid;
- #endif
